The Texas Wranglers is a basketball team in the United Basketball League in Dallas, Texas. Their inaugural season was in November 2006 when they played in the American Basketball Association.
History [edit]
In March 2006, the franchise was announced as an expansion team for the 2006-07 season. Wranglers head coaches Ozzie Denson and Toni Oppliger announced the practice and game venues at their second press conference on July 13. League games are scheduled to take place at the Deering Center gym of Reicher Catholic High School, a TAPPS Class 4A parochial school in Waco, Texas. The team has been and will continue to practice at the Texas State Technical College gymnasium.
In February 2007 they announced that they would begin play in the UBL for the inaugural 2008 season.
